Join Our Team as a Healthcare Support Worker

We are seeking experienced Healthcare Assistants to work in Hospital Healthcare Support Work shifts at the Ulster Hospital. This is a fantastic opportunity to gain paid, public service experience through a multi-award winning, tier one supplier of Healthcare Support Work staff to the NHS.

Why Choose Keenan Recruitment?
  • We are a contracted, top tier supplier of Professional staff to the HSCNI and other public bodies, meaning we receive 100s of jobs for you to pick from throughout Northern Ireland.
  • A free & confidential financial wellbeing package is offered via an external professional body to all temporary workers, to aid you with your mortgage application, debt and budgeting planning and for pension advice etc.
  • You will have a dedicated specialist Consultant.
  • We have over 30 years experience suppling staff to the public service.
  • We will guide you through the process of ensuring you are fully compliant, so you and your patients are protected.

As a Healthcare Support Worker, you will have a minimum of 6 months paid care assistant experience gained in the last 2 years. You will be willing to undergo an Enhanced Access NI police check through Keenan.
